What Does It Mean When an AI Pilot Has No Results?
A pilot with no measurable result is still running. The model works. Someone checks its output most weeks. But no one in the business can put a number on what it has changed.
This is a different problem to a pilot that never reaches production. AI Navi's guide to why AI agent pilots stall before production covers the earlier failure point: projects that stall in the demo stage because nobody planned for data drift, infrastructure cost or ownership. An unaudited pilot has already cleared that bar. It shipped. It runs. The gap sits further downstream: nobody defined how success would be measured, so nobody can now say whether it succeeded.
Signs a pilot needs an audit rather than more patience:
- It has been running for 90 days or more without a declared outcome
- The team can describe what the tool does but not what it has changed in the P&L
- Board updates describe activity, such as users onboarded or queries processed, rather than a business result
- Ownership of “did this work” sits with whoever built the pilot, not whoever depends on the result

How Do You Audit an AI Pilot That's Already Running?
Step 1: Recover the original intended outcome
Find the business case, the kick-off deck, or the sponsor's original brief. Extract the single business metric the pilot was meant to move, such as forecast accuracy, deduction recovery rate, or cost per drop. If no such metric exists in writing, that is the finding: the pilot launched without one.
Step 2: Reconstruct a baseline, even without a clean one
Few unaudited pilots have a pre-launch baseline sitting ready to use. Most businesses still have close proxies available: the manual process the pilot replaced, the same metric from the same period last year, or a comparable business unit still running the old way. A proxy baseline, clearly labelled as such, is enough to start measuring delta. Waiting for a perfect baseline is how pilots stay unaudited for another quarter.
Step 3: Name the data owner and the system of record
Someone needs to own pulling the before-and-after numbers on a fixed cadence, and that system needs to be named, not assumed. Across CP/FMCG and logistics diagnostics, this is the step most pilots skip. The model has an owner. The business case rarely does.
Step 4: Set a decision date and the criteria for keep, fix or kill
An audit without a deadline becomes another open-ended pilot. Fix a date, typically 30 to 45 days out, and agree in advance what result justifies continued funding, what triggers a scoped fix, and what triggers a stop.

What Data Do You Need to Make a Keep, Fix or Kill Decision?
A defensible decision needs four things on paper, not in someone's head:
- The current-state proxy metric and where it came from
- The system of record that will supply the same metric going forward
- A review cadence, typically monthly, with a named attendee from finance or operations
- The specific P&L line the result maps to, whether that is margin per SKU, cost per drop, or working capital
If any of the four is missing, the pilot is not ready for a keep decision yet, regardless of how confident the team building it sounds.
How Long Should You Give an Unaudited Pilot Before Deciding?
There is no universal answer, but there is a useful outside reference point. McKinsey's most recent global AI survey, fielded across nearly 2,000 organisations in mid-2025, found that most respondents remained in the experimentation or piloting stage, and that only around 6% of organisations qualified as “AI high performers” attributing a significant, measurable share of profit to AI. The organisations that cleared that bar shared one trait more than any other: they had redesigned the workflow the AI sat inside, not just added the tool to the existing one.
A separate 2026 survey of 3,235 senior leaders by Deloitte's AI Institute found a similar pattern from a different angle: more organisations now say their AI strategy is well prepared, but far fewer feel equally prepared on the data and infrastructure needed to prove it. Strategy readiness and measurement readiness are not the same thing, and most businesses have more of the first than the second.
The practical implication for a pilot already running past its original timeline is this: extra time alone rarely closes that gap. A pilot given another quarter without a baseline, an owner or a decision date is not more likely to produce a result. It is more likely to still be unaudited at the next board review.
What Happens After the Audit?
The audit produces one of three outcomes.
Keep. The reconstructed baseline shows a genuine, attributable result. Report it to the board in P&L terms and move the pilot onto the same review cadence as any other operational system. How to present AI ROI to your board covers how to package that result for a CFO audience.
Fix. The technology and the intended outcome are both sound, but the measurement layer, data ownership, or integration was never built. This is scoped, bounded work, not a restart. Kill. The audit shows the original outcome was never well defined, the data to measure it does not exist and would be disproportionately expensive to build, or the underlying process has since changed enough that the pilot is solving yesterday's problem. Retiring a pilot on the evidence of an audit is a different, more defensible conversation with the board than quietly letting it run unmeasured.
